Skip to content

Commit 18b98c5

Browse files
committed
Merge remote-tracking branch 'upstream/main' into managed-devices
2 parents 6374148 + 904708a commit 18b98c5

File tree

10 files changed

+35
-34
lines changed

10 files changed

+35
-34
lines changed

README.md

+3-3
Original file line numberDiff line numberDiff line change
@@ -244,16 +244,16 @@ To run it, you'll have to:
244244

245245
```groovy
246246
dependencies {
247-
implementation 'com.google.maps.android:maps-compose:2.7.2'
247+
implementation 'com.google.maps.android:maps-compose:2.7.3'
248248
249249
// Make sure to also include the latest version of the Maps SDK for Android
250250
implementation 'com.google.android.gms:play-services-maps:18.0.2'
251251
252252
// Also include Compose version `1.2.0-alpha03` or higher - for example:
253-
implementation 'androidx.compose.foundation:foundation:2.7.2-alpha03'
253+
implementation 'androidx.compose.foundation:foundation:2.7.3-alpha03'
254254
255255
// Optionally, you can include the widgets library if you want to use ScaleBar, etc.
256-
implementation 'com.google.maps.android:maps-compose-widgets:2.7.2'
256+
implementation 'com.google.maps.android:maps-compose-widgets:2.7.3'
257257
}
258258
```
259259

app/build.gradle

+5-3
Original file line numberDiff line numberDiff line change
@@ -5,12 +5,12 @@ plugins {
55
}
66

77
android {
8-
compileSdk 32
8+
namespace "com.google.maps.android.compose"
9+
compileSdk 33
910

1011
defaultConfig {
11-
applicationId "com.google.maps.android.compose"
1212
minSdk 21
13-
targetSdk 32
13+
targetSdk 33
1414
versionCode 1
1515
versionName "1.0"
1616

@@ -50,6 +50,7 @@ android {
5050
}
5151

5252
dependencies {
53+
implementation platform(libs.androidx.compose.bom)
5354
implementation libs.androidx.compose.activity
5455
implementation libs.androidx.compose.foundation
5556
implementation libs.androidx.compose.material
@@ -60,6 +61,7 @@ dependencies {
6061
implementation libs.androidx.compose.ui.preview.tooling
6162
debugImplementation libs.androidx.compose.ui.tooling
6263

64+
androidTestImplementation platform(libs.androidx.compose.bom)
6365
androidTestImplementation libs.androidx.test.core
6466
androidTestImplementation libs.androidx.test.rules
6567
androidTestImplementation libs.androidx.test.runner

app/src/main/AndroidManifest.xml

+1-2
Original file line numberDiff line numberDiff line change
@@ -15,8 +15,7 @@
1515
limitations under the License.
1616
-->
1717

18-
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
19-
package="com.google.maps.android.compose">
18+
<manifest xmlns:android="http://schemas.android.com/apk/res/android">
2019

2120
<uses-permission android:name="android.permission.INTERNET" />
2221

build.gradle

+1-2
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,6 @@
22
buildscript {
33
ext.kotlin_version = libs.versions.kotlin.get()
44
ext.compose_compiler_version = libs.versions.composecompiler.get()
5-
ext.compose_version = libs.versions.compose.get()
65
ext.androidx_test_version = libs.versions.androidxtest.get()
76
repositories {
87
google()
@@ -31,7 +30,7 @@ ext.projectArtifactId = { project ->
3130

3231
allprojects {
3332
group = 'com.google.maps.android'
34-
version = '2.7.2'
33+
version = '2.7.3'
3534
project.ext.artifactId = rootProject.ext.projectArtifactId(project)
3635
}
3736

gradle/libs.versions.toml

+11-10
Original file line numberDiff line numberDiff line change
@@ -1,30 +1,31 @@
11
[versions]
2-
activitycompose = "1.4.0"
3-
agp = "7.2.0"
2+
activitycompose = "1.6.1"
3+
agp = "7.3.1"
44
androidxtest = "1.4.0"
5-
compose = "1.2.1"
6-
composecompiler = "1.3.0"
5+
compose-bom = "2022.11.00"
6+
composecompiler = "1.3.2"
77
coroutines = "1.6.0"
88
dokka = "1.5.0"
99
espresso = "3.4.0"
1010
jacoco-plugin = "0.2"
1111
jacoco-tool-plugin = "0.8.7"
1212
junitktx = "1.1.3"
1313
junit = "4.13.2"
14-
kotlin = "1.7.10"
14+
kotlin = "1.7.20"
1515
material = "1.5.0"
1616
maps = "3.3.0"
1717
mapsecrets = "2.0.1"
1818

1919
[libraries]
2020
android-gradle-plugin = { module = "com.android.tools.build:gradle", version.ref = "agp" }
2121
androidx-compose-activity = { module = "androidx.activity:activity-compose", version.ref = "activitycompose" }
22-
androidx-compose-foundation = { module = "androidx.compose.foundation:foundation", version.ref = "compose" }
23-
androidx-compose-material = { module = "androidx.compose.material:material", version.ref = "compose" }
24-
androidx-compose-ui-preview-tooling = { module = "androidx.compose.ui:ui-tooling-preview", version.ref = "compose" }
25-
androidx-compose-ui-tooling = { module = "androidx.compose.ui:ui-tooling", version.ref = "compose" }
22+
androidx-compose-bom = { module = "androidx.compose:compose-bom", version.ref = "compose-bom" }
23+
androidx-compose-foundation = { module = "androidx.compose.foundation:foundation" }
24+
androidx-compose-material = { module = "androidx.compose.material:material" }
25+
androidx-compose-ui-preview-tooling = { module = "androidx.compose.ui:ui-tooling-preview" }
26+
androidx-compose-ui-tooling = { module = "androidx.compose.ui:ui-tooling" }
2627
androidx-core = { module = "androidx.core:core-ktx", version.require = "1.7.0" }
27-
androidx-test-compose-ui = { module = "androidx.compose.ui:ui-test-junit4", version.ref = "compose" }
28+
androidx-test-compose-ui = { module = "androidx.compose.ui:ui-test-junit4" }
2829
androidx-test-core = { module = "androidx.test:core", version.ref = "androidxtest" }
2930
androidx-test-espresso = { module = "androidx.test.espresso:espresso-core", version.ref = "espresso" }
3031
androidx-test-junit-ktx = { module = "androidx.test.ext:junit-ktx", version.ref = "junitktx" }
+2-2
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
1-
#Fri Dec 03 15:01:34 PST 2021
1+
#Thu Nov 17 17:56:49 EST 2022
22
distributionBase=GRADLE_USER_HOME
3-
distributionUrl=https\://services.gradle.org/distributions/gradle-7.3.3-bin.zip
3+
distributionUrl=https\://services.gradle.org/distributions/gradle-7.5.1-bin.zip
44
distributionPath=wrapper/dists
55
zipStorePath=wrapper/dists
66
zipStoreBase=GRADLE_USER_HOME

maps-compose-widgets/build.gradle

+5-3
Original file line numberDiff line numberDiff line change
@@ -4,11 +4,12 @@ plugins {
44
}
55

66
android {
7-
compileSdk 32
7+
namespace "com.google.maps.android.compose.widgets"
8+
compileSdk 33
89

910
defaultConfig {
1011
minSdk 21
11-
targetSdk 32
12+
targetSdk 33
1213
versionCode 1
1314
versionName "1.0"
1415
}
@@ -37,6 +38,7 @@ android {
3738
dependencies {
3839
implementation project(':maps-compose')
3940

41+
implementation platform(libs.androidx.compose.bom)
4042
implementation libs.androidx.compose.foundation
4143
implementation libs.androidx.compose.material
4244
implementation libs.androidx.core
@@ -46,7 +48,7 @@ dependencies {
4648
implementation libs.maps.ktx.utils
4749

4850
testImplementation libs.test.junit
49-
51+
androidTestImplementation platform(libs.androidx.compose.bom)
5052
androidTestImplementation libs.androidx.test.espresso
5153
androidTestImplementation libs.androidx.test.junit.ktx
5254
}

maps-compose-widgets/src/main/AndroidManifest.xml

+1-3
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,4 @@
1515
limitations under the License.
1616
-->
1717

18-
<manifest package="com.google.maps.android.compose.widgets">
19-
20-
</manifest>
18+
<manifest />

maps-compose/build.gradle

+5-2
Original file line numberDiff line numberDiff line change
@@ -4,11 +4,12 @@ plugins {
44
}
55

66
android {
7-
compileSdk 32
7+
namespace "com.google.maps.android.compose"
8+
compileSdk 33
89

910
defaultConfig {
1011
minSdk 21
11-
targetSdk 32
12+
targetSdk 33
1213
versionCode 1
1314
versionName "1.0"
1415
}
@@ -35,6 +36,7 @@ android {
3536
}
3637

3738
dependencies {
39+
implementation platform(libs.androidx.compose.bom)
3840
implementation libs.androidx.core
3941
implementation libs.androidx.compose.foundation
4042
implementation libs.kotlin
@@ -43,6 +45,7 @@ dependencies {
4345

4446
testImplementation libs.test.junit
4547

48+
androidTestImplementation platform(libs.androidx.compose.bom)
4649
androidTestImplementation libs.androidx.test.espresso
4750
androidTestImplementation libs.androidx.test.junit.ktx
4851
}

maps-compose/src/main/AndroidManifest.xml

+1-4
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,4 @@
1515
limitations under the License.
1616
-->
1717

18-
<manifest xmlns:android="http://schemas.android.com/apk/res/android"
19-
package="com.google.maps.android.compose">
20-
21-
</manifest>
18+
<manifest />

0 commit comments

Comments
 (0)